Multiple State Parks Are Closed Again Following Last Week’s Snow and Ice Storm
After an unprecedented network-wide shutdown due to COVID-19 last spring, staffing shortages throughout 2020, and then historic fires that burned land in September, the agency has now been forced to close multiple properties again following last week’s storm. At least nine parks are temporarily off limits to the public, either because of damage caused by snow and ice accumulation, power outages, or in some cases, a combination of both.
